你能够经过以下链接下载《MySQL实战45讲》PDF资源:
1. 极客时刻网站:你能够在极客时刻网站上找到《MySQL实战45讲》的完好内容,合适需求进步MySQL技术的开发者或进行MySQL运维的同学。拜访。
2. 我爱下载网站:该网站供给《MySQL实战45讲》中文PDF完好版,合适深化学习MySQL。拜访。
3. CSDN博客:你能够在CSDN博客上找到《MySQL实战45讲》的百度网盘链接,提取码为1119。拜访。
4. GitBook:该渠道供给《MySQL实战45讲》的完好内容,合适体系性学习MySQL。拜访。
5. ZLibrary:你能够在ZLibrary上在线阅览或免费下载《MySQL实战45讲》。拜访。
期望这些资源对你有所协助,祝你学习愉快!
本文依据《MySQL实战45讲》PDF内容,旨在为广阔数据库开发者供给一份体系性的MySQL学习指南。本文将依照书本的结构,对MySQL的根底架构、业务、锁、索引、日志等重要知识点进行具体解说,协助读者深化了解MySQL的原理和使用。
MySQL作为一款高性能、牢靠的数据库办理体系,其根底架构是其中心竞赛力的表现。以下是MySQL根底架构的几个要害组成部分:
1.1 衔接器
衔接器担任处理客户端与MySQL服务器的衔接恳求,包含树立衔接、验证用户身份等。衔接器是MySQL架构中的第一个组件,也是整个架构的进口。
1.2 查询缓存
查询缓存是MySQL的一种优化手法,它能够将查询成果缓存起来,以便后续相同的查询能够直接从缓存中获取成果,然后进步查询功率。
1.3 剖析器
剖析器担任解析SQL句子,将其转换为MySQL能够了解的格局。剖析器包含词法剖析、语法剖析、语义剖析等进程。
1.4 优化器
优化器担任依据查询句子生成最优的履行计划。优化器会考虑多种要素,如索引、表衔接次序等,以确认最有用的查询履行办法。
1.5 履行器
履行器担任履行优化器生成的履行计划,包含数据检索、更新、删去等操作。履行器是衔接存储引擎和上层服务的桥梁。
业务是数据库操作的基本单位,它确保了数据的一致性和完好性。以下是业务与锁的相关知识点:
2.1 业务
业务由一系列操作组成,这些操作要么悉数成功,要么悉数失利。MySQL支撑业务的ACID特性,即原子性、一致性、阻隔性和持久性。
2.2 锁
锁是数据库并发操控的重要机制,它确保了多个业务在履行进程中不会彼此搅扰。MySQL支撑多种锁类型,如同享锁、排他锁、行锁、表锁等。
2.3 死锁与死锁检测
死锁是指两个或多个业务在履行进程中,因为资源竞赛而导致的彼此等候,终究无法持续履行。MySQL供给了死锁检测机制,以处理死锁问题。
索引是进步数据库查询功率的要害要素。以下是索引与查询优化的相关知识点:
3.1 索引
索引是一种数据结构,它能够协助数据库快速定位数据。MySQL支撑多种索引类型,如B树索引、哈希索引、全文索引等。
3.2 查询优化
查询优化是指经过调整查询句子、索引、表结构等手法,进步查询功率的进程。MySQL供给了多种查询优化战略,如索引提示、查询重写等。
日志和备份是确保数据库安全性的重要手法。以下是日志与备份的相关知识点:
4.1 日志
日志是记载数据库操作前史的一种机制,它能够协助数据库康复到某个时刻点的状况。MySQL支撑多种日志类型,如redo log、binlog等。
4.2 备份
备份是指将数据库数据复制到其他存储介质的进程,以便在数据丢掉或损坏时进行康复。MySQL供给了多种备份办法,如全量备份、增量备份等。
本文依据《MySQL实战45讲》PDF内容,对MySQL的根底架构、业务、锁、索引、日志等重要知识点进行了具体解说。经过学习本文,读者能够深化了解MySQL的原理和使用,为实践开发作业打下坚实根底。
pubmed数据库官网,深化探究PubMed数据库官网——生物医学文献检索的宝库
PubMed数据库的官方网站是:。这个网站供给了超越3700万条生物医学文献的引证,包含来自MEDLINE、生命科学期刊和在线书本的内容...
2025-01-11
2025-01-11 #数据库
苹果电脑怎样装windows体系,苹果电脑装置Windows体系的具体攻略
2025-01-11 #操作系统
pubmed数据库官网,深化探究PubMed数据库官网——生物医学文献检索的宝库
2025-01-11 #数据库
2025-01-11 #操作系统